Figures 6Go, 7Go, and 8Go, which appeared in the paper, "Na-Fe-Ca Alteration and LREE (Th-Nb) Mineralization in Marble and Granitoids of Sierra de Sumampa, Santiago del Estero, Argentina" (Franchini et al., 2005, v. 100, p. 733–764), are reproduced here with improved color and resolution.

FIG. 6. Photographs of different Na-Fe-Ca alteration styles and intensity in granite and comendite. Ja-30: Fresh, medium grained granite. Ja-25: Incipient fenitization with an aegirine vein and aegirine + albite clusters. Ja-28: Moderate fenitization with quartz dissolution near aegirine vein walls and strong albitization of feldspars.
